Hello, so im converting a hardtail mountain bike to a 3000w 72v e bike. For the upgrades on the bike itself, what would ypu reccomend. I am trying to save some money on this by the way. I assume i should upgrade the fork (any reccomendations on what fork?) And then the brakes... im thinking 4 piston hydraulic brakes? (Any reccomendations on what brand?) And what rotor size? Personally I think 3000w in a hardtail is dangerous, dual suspension is “less” dangerous with far better suspension compliance at the sorts of speeds you’ll be travelling at.

For brakes you’ll probably need something decent like Hayes Dominion A4, Magura MT7,etc or similar with 203mm rotors as a starting point.
